Interface: FlowProps
Table of contents
Properties
- __experimentalFeatures
- applyDefault
- autoConnect
- connectOnClick
- connectionLineOptions
- connectionLineStyle
- connectionLineType
- connectionMode
- defaultEdgeOptions
- defaultMarkerColor
- defaultViewport
- deleteKeyCode
- disableKeyboardA11y
- edgeTypes
- edgeUpdaterRadius
- edges
- edgesFocusable
- edgesUpdatable
- elementsSelectable
- elevateEdgesOnSelect
- elevateNodesOnSelect
- fitViewOnInit
- id
- maxZoom
- minZoom
- modelValue
- multiSelectionKeyCode
- noDragClassName
- noPanClassName
- noWheelClassName
- nodeExtent
- nodeTypes
- nodes
- nodesConnectable
- nodesDraggable
- nodesFocusable
- onlyRenderVisibleElements
- panActivationKeyCode
- panOnDrag
- panOnScroll
- panOnScrollMode
- panOnScrollSpeed
- preventScrolling
- selectNodesOnDrag
- selectionKeyCode
- selectionMode
- snapGrid
- snapToGrid
- translateExtent
- zoomActivationKeyCode
- zoomOnDoubleClick
- zoomOnPinch
- zoomOnScroll
Properties
__experimentalFeatures
• Optional
__experimentalFeatures: Object
Type declaration
Name | Type |
---|---|
nestedFlow? | boolean |
applyDefault
• Optional
applyDefault: boolean
autoConnect
• Optional
autoConnect: boolean
| Connector
connectOnClick
• Optional
connectOnClick: boolean
connectionLineOptions
• Optional
connectionLineOptions: ConnectionLineOptions
connectionLineStyle
• Optional
connectionLineStyle: null
| CSSProperties
connectionLineType
• Optional
connectionLineType: ConnectionLineType
connectionMode
• Optional
connectionMode: ConnectionMode
defaultEdgeOptions
• Optional
defaultEdgeOptions: DefaultEdgeOptions
defaultMarkerColor
• Optional
defaultMarkerColor: string
defaultViewport
• Optional
defaultViewport: ViewportTransform
deleteKeyCode
• Optional
deleteKeyCode: null
| KeyFilter
disableKeyboardA11y
• Optional
disableKeyboardA11y: boolean
edgeTypes
• Optional
edgeTypes: EdgeTypesObject
edgeUpdaterRadius
• Optional
edgeUpdaterRadius: number
edges
• Optional
edges: Edge
<any
, any
>[]
edgesFocusable
• Optional
edgesFocusable: boolean
edgesUpdatable
• Optional
edgesUpdatable: EdgeUpdatable
elementsSelectable
• Optional
elementsSelectable: boolean
elevateEdgesOnSelect
• Optional
elevateEdgesOnSelect: boolean
elevateNodesOnSelect
• Optional
elevateNodesOnSelect: boolean
fitViewOnInit
• Optional
fitViewOnInit: boolean
id
• Optional
id: string
maxZoom
• Optional
maxZoom: number
minZoom
• Optional
minZoom: number
modelValue
• Optional
modelValue: Elements
<any
, any
, any
, any
>
multiSelectionKeyCode
• Optional
multiSelectionKeyCode: null
| KeyFilter
noDragClassName
• Optional
noDragClassName: string
noPanClassName
• Optional
noPanClassName: string
noWheelClassName
• Optional
noWheelClassName: string
nodeExtent
• Optional
nodeExtent: CoordinateExtent
nodeTypes
• Optional
nodeTypes: NodeTypesObject
nodes
• Optional
nodes: Node
<any
, any
>[]
nodesConnectable
• Optional
nodesConnectable: boolean
nodesDraggable
• Optional
nodesDraggable: boolean
nodesFocusable
• Optional
nodesFocusable: boolean
onlyRenderVisibleElements
• Optional
onlyRenderVisibleElements: boolean
panActivationKeyCode
• Optional
panActivationKeyCode: null
| KeyFilter
panOnDrag
• Optional
panOnDrag: boolean
| number
[]
panOnScroll
• Optional
panOnScroll: boolean
panOnScrollMode
• Optional
panOnScrollMode: PanOnScrollMode
panOnScrollSpeed
• Optional
panOnScrollSpeed: number
preventScrolling
• Optional
preventScrolling: boolean
selectNodesOnDrag
• Optional
selectNodesOnDrag: boolean
selectionKeyCode
• Optional
selectionKeyCode: null
| KeyFilter
selectionMode
• Optional
selectionMode: SelectionMode
snapGrid
• Optional
snapGrid: SnapGrid
snapToGrid
• Optional
snapToGrid: boolean
translateExtent
• Optional
translateExtent: CoordinateExtent
zoomActivationKeyCode
• Optional
zoomActivationKeyCode: null
| KeyFilter
zoomOnDoubleClick
• Optional
zoomOnDoubleClick: boolean
zoomOnPinch
• Optional
zoomOnPinch: boolean
zoomOnScroll
• Optional
zoomOnScroll: boolean